The Indiana Department of Transportation announces a road closure on State Road 340 in Clay County.
Beginning on or after Monday, July 21, crews will be replacing the bridge over Purdy Run on S.R. 340 between County Road 500 W. and County Road 550 W. Construction is anticipated to last until late September but is weather-dependent and subject to change.
The official detour around the closure follows S.R. 340 to U.S. 40 W. & S.R. 340 to U.S. 40 E.
